What to Confirm Before Booking in Long Creek
Use these checks when comparing bathroom contractors serving Long Creek. They are designed to make each estimate more specific, easier to verify, and less dependent on generic averages.
- Request the waterproofing method for showers before tile work begins.
- Verify payment milestones before signing a remodeling contract.
- Ask how hidden water damage or framing issues are priced if found after demolition.
- Confirm whether electrical, plumbing, ventilation, and permit work are subcontracted.
- Ask for the estimate, warranty, exclusions, and scheduling assumptions in writing.

How Long Creek Homeowners Can Pressure-Test Quotes
Long Creek is a smaller Oregon market with about 168 residents, so travel minimums, technician routing, and service-area coverage deserve extra confirmation. The place-area data works out to roughly 164 residents per square mile, so drive time, rural access, and minimum trip charges can matter.
For bathroom remodeling, that means the bid should separate allowances, waterproofing, trade work, demolition findings, permit timing, and payment milestones.
| Estimate item | Why it matters | Question to ask |
|---|---|---|
| Waterproofing method | Tile and grout are not waterproof by themselves, so the system behind them matters. | Which waterproofing product or method is included before tile starts? |
| Change orders | Hidden water damage, rot, or framing problems are often discovered after demolition. | How are hidden conditions documented, approved, and priced? |
| Trade work | Plumbing, electrical, ventilation, and framing changes can require separate scheduling or permits. | Which trades are in-house, subcontracted, or excluded? |
| Timeline control | Material lead times and inspection windows can affect the usable-bathroom date. | What must be selected before the start date is locked? |
When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Long Creek
Call sooner when you see
- Unsafe electrical, poor ventilation, or mold-like growth tied to moisture.
- Active leaking, soft flooring, failed shower pan, or visible water damage.
- A one-bath home where demolition timing must be coordinated carefully.
Plan ahead for
- Temporary bathroom planning for occupied homes.
- Material ordering before a preferred contractor start date.
- Fixture, vanity, tile, and glass selections before demolition.

Hiring a Bath Remodeler in Long Creek
Selecting the right bathroom contractor in Long Creek makes all the difference:
- Licensing: Verify Oregon contractor license and specialty certifications
- Insurance: Confirm liability and workers' compensation coverage
- Experience: Review their bathroom-specific portfolio and references
- Communication: Assess responsiveness and willingness to answer questions
- Contract: Get detailed written scope, timeline, and payment schedule
- Warranty: Understand coverage on workmanship and materials
Long Creek Remodel Time Expectations
Realistic timelines for Long Creek bathroom projects:
- Basic refresh (1-2 weeks): Paint, fixtures, hardware—no plumbing changes
- Standard remodel (2-4 weeks): New vanity, tub/shower, flooring—same layout
- Full renovation (4-8 weeks): Complete gut job with plumbing and electrical changes
Add 2-4 weeks for permit processing, custom orders, and scheduling in busy seasons.

What should I budget for unexpected costs in Long Creek?
Plan for 10-20% extra in your Long Creek bathroom budget for unexpected issues like water damage, mold, or outdated plumbing discovered during demolition.
